WESTPORT — A 51-year-old man, charged with disorderly conduct in February, faces followup charges filed in connection with the earlier offense.

James Longtie, of Westport, was charged March 2 with violating the conditions of his release and second-degree failure to appear.

Longtie, facing a disorderly conduct allegation in connection with what police described as a Feb. 17 “domestic violence incident,” was issued a temporary court order to stay away from the complainant until his Feb. 20 court date, according to the report. 

Officers were summoned March 2 to the same residence on a call unrelated to domestic disruption and found Longtie, who had failed to appear in court Feb. 20 as ordered and, as a result, was in violation of the temporary court order, police said.

Longtie was arrested on the new charges and held on $20,000 bond for arraignment the next day at state Superior Court in Stamford.
